Эмуляция
Материал из Motr Wiki.
Под операционными системами Unix и Linux работа игры Ragnarok Online возможна при использовании эмуляторов, таких как Wine.
Особенности запуска RO под эмуляцией на сервере MOTR
Тем не менее, с клиентом сервера MOTR такая эмуляция не работает после добавления в первой половине 2007 года в ruro.exe стороннего компонента, несовместимого с эмуляцией. Не исключено, что в дальнейшем совместимость с эмуляторами будет восстановлена.
При экспериментах с запуском клиента MOTRпод эмуляцией следует учитывать следующие особенности.
- Первый запуск ruro.exe сопровождается созданием файла rurocach.dat. Среди прочего в этом файле содержится генерируемая эвристически информация об особенностях клиента. Поиск этой информации под эмулятором wine занимает очень много времени из-за медленной имплементации некоторых API. Если ruro.exe не находит информацию или обнаруживает необходимость ее создать заново, то эта процедура под Wine может занимать десятки минут, что создает впечатление подвисшего клиента.
- Для уменьшения количества dependency рекомендуется запускать ruro.exe с ключом /NoGui
